asp.net with angular application
If that is based on the controller-pattern, then it already is an MVC application!
But, if that is some of the older technologies, such as Web Forms (correct me if I am wrong), then I recommend that not only just you need to revamp the
View
part of it, but also the backend of the application as well.
Quote:
what is the best way to easily convert it.
I would recommend using ASP.NET Core now, since it is the recommended approach to web application development. ASP.NET Core comes shipped with some boilerplate code for Angular apps too.
